Nesodden is a municipality in Viken ( Norway ) and has 19,616 inhabitants (as of February 27, 2020). The administrative seat is in Varden . The residents of the parish are called Nesodding .

geography

Nesodden is located on the peninsula of the same name , bounded by the Oslofjord on the west side and the Bunnefjord on the east side, about seven kilometers south of Oslo . Furthermore, smaller islands such as Steilene , Ildjernet and Langøyene belong to the municipal area. While the land on the coast drops steeply, the terrain in the interior of the peninsula is rather hilly. The highest point in the municipality is Toåsen with 215  moh.

From 1995 to 2005 the population increased by 16 percent. The area in the north and west of the municipality is the most densely populated, with Torvik in the east and Fagerstrand in the south.

Nesodden is connected to downtown Oslo by a passenger ferry. The distance by land to Oslo is about 47 kilometers by road.

history

Before the regional reform in Norway , Nesodden belonged to the former Fylke Akershus . As part of the reform, Akershus was transferred to the newly created Viken province on January 1, 2020.

In the municipality is the Nesodden kirke , a Romanesque stone church from the twelfth century. It is protected as a cultural monument.

economy

More than half of the residents of Nesodden work outside the municipality, the majority of them in the Norwegian capital, Oslo. The Sunnaas Sykehus hospital is the second largest company after Nesodden municipality and offers rehabilitation measures for seriously injured patients. Both industrial and agricultural production are barely developed in the municipality.

coat of arms

The coat of arms of Nesodden, which has been official since 1986, shows a silver tip on a blue background. It is supposed to represent the peninsula between the two fjords.
